NVD · unedited
The Appointment Booking Calendar — Simply Schedule Appointments Booking Plugin plugin for WordPress is vulnerable to denial of service in all versions up to, and including, 1.6.11.5. This is due to a publicly accessible REST API endpoint (/wp-json/ssa/v1/async) that calls PHP's sleep() function on a user-supplied delay parameter without any rate limiting. This makes it possible for unauthenticated attackers to exhaust PHP worker processes, denying access to the site to legitimate users.

dbcve analysis · high confidence

The Simply Schedule Appointments WordPress plugin contains a publicly accessible REST API endpoint (/wp-json/ssa/v1/async) that accepts a user-supplied delay parameter and passes it directly to PHP's sleep() function without any rate limiting or input validation. This allows unauthenticated attackers to repeatedly invoke the endpoint with large delay values, causing PHP worker processes to block and exhaust server resources, resulting in denial of service for legitimate users.

MitigationUpdate the plugin to version 1.6.12 or later which addresses this vulnerability, or implement web application firewall (WAF) rules to rate-limit or block requests to the vulnerable endpoint until the update can be applied.

Work through these to decide whether this CVE applies to you.

  1. Verify the plugin is installed
    Check the WordPress plugins directory for 'simply-schedule-appointments' folder, or query the WordPress database: SELECT * FROM wp_options WHERE option_name = 'active_plugins';
    Affected if The Simply Schedule Appointments plugin appears in the active plugins list
  2. Determine installed plugin version
    Read the plugin header from simply-schedule-appointments/ssa.php or simply-schedule-appointments/index.php to find the Version: field, or check in WordPress admin under Plugins > Installed Plugins
    Affected if The version listed is below 1.6.11.6 (or the version cannot be determined and the plugin is present)
  3. Confirm the vulnerable endpoint is accessible
    Send a GET or POST request to /wp-json/ssa/v1/async?delay=5 (or with delay as a POST parameter). A response indicates the endpoint exists.
    Affected if The endpoint returns any valid JSON response (indicating the REST API is registered and reachable)
  4. Test if delay parameter is processed
    Send a request to /wp-json/ssa/v1/async with a delay parameter (e.g., delay=60). Measure the response time - it should take approximately the specified seconds.
    Affected if The response is delayed by approximately the number of seconds specified in the delay parameter

A user is affected if the Simply Schedule Appointments plugin is installed with a version below 1.6.11.6 AND the /wp-json/ssa/v1/async endpoint is accessible and honors the delay parameter, allowing arbitrary sleep injection.
